Anthropic has purchased the stealth biotech AI startup Coefficient Bio in a $400 million stock deal, according to The Information and Eric Newcomer.

OpenAI is experiencing significant leadership changes as CEO of AGI deployment, Fidji Simo, takes medical leave due to a neuroimmune condition. During her absence, OpenAI president Greg Brockman will oversee product initiatives, including the super app efforts, while other executives manage business operations.

Meta is increasingly integrating AI tools into its operations, requiring employees to adopt these technologies to advance. The company aims to enhance productivity by leveraging AI coding tools, setting ambitious goals for engineers to produce a significant portion of their code with AI assistance. This shift raises concerns about the future of employment within Meta as the demand for traditional roles may diminish.

The auto industry is leveraging AI to tackle challenges like supply chain disruptions and rising costs. Executives at the New York Auto Show emphasized that AI could significantly shorten vehicle development timelines, making companies more agile in responding to market demands. Nissan aims for a 36-month development cycle for new powertrains, while Hyundai is also exploring AI to enhance efficiency.

The Brazilian information technology market is expected to reach $67.8 billion in 2025, reflecting an 18.5% growth compared to 2024. Despite this robust growth, the projection for 2026 is only 5.3%, below the global average.

American healthcare struggles with a paradox of advanced technology yet prolonged diagnostic journeys for patients, especially children with neurological conditions. Genomic sequencing, a powerful tool, is underutilized early in the care process, leading to significant costs. Evidence shows that introducing genomic insights earlier can reduce healthcare expenses by up to $80,000 per child annually.
